Exactly what are Stem Cells?
Stem cells are undifferentiated cells which have the amazing capacity to produce into diverse cell kinds in the body. They function a maintenance process, replenishing other cells providing the organism is alive. Contrary to standard cells, that have particular functions and lifespans, stem cells can divide and renew on their own in excess of extensive durations, occasionally indefinitely.

Stem cells are categorized dependent on their own possible to differentiate into other cell types. The two Principal styles are embryonic stem cells and Grownup (or somatic) stem cells.

Kinds of Stem Cells
Embryonic Stem Cells (ESCs): These cells are derived from embryos that happen to be a few to 5 times old. At this stage, the embryo is actually a blastocyst, consisting of about one hundred fifty cells. ESCs are pluripotent, this means they can create into any cell type in the body. This versatility helps make them priceless for clinical investigate and opportunity remedies. Nevertheless, their use is additionally controversial on account of ethical considerations regarding the source of these cells.

Grownup Stem Cells: Also known as somatic stem cells, these cells are found in various tissues through the body, including the bone marrow, Mind, and liver. Not like embryonic stem cells, adult stem cells are multipotent; they are able to develop right into a minimal variety of cell types connected to the tissue of origin. For instance, hematopoietic stem cells located in the bone marrow can provide rise to differing kinds of blood cells but not to cells of other tissues.

Induced Pluripotent Stem Cells (iPSCs): iPSCs are adult cells that were genetically reprogrammed to behave like embryonic stem cells. This implies they are able to potentially differentiate into any mobile type in your body. The invention of iPSCs has opened new avenues for analysis and therapy, featuring a means to create pluripotent stem cells with no ethical considerations related to ESCs.

Possible Applications of Stem Cells in Drugs
Stem mobile analysis holds assure for dealing with an array of illnesses and injuries, owing to their regenerative talents. Several of the most promising programs include:

Regenerative Drugs and Tissue Engineering: Stem cells could perhaps be used to regenerate damaged tissues and organs. For illustration, researchers are exploring the usage of stem cells to fix coronary heart tissue after a coronary heart attack or to generate insulin-developing stem cell treatment cells for individuals with diabetic issues.

Treatment method of Neurodegenerative Illnesses: Disorders like Parkinson’s ailment, Alzheimer’s illness, and spinal wire injuries entail the loss of distinct cell forms. Stem cell therapy could swap these misplaced cells, most likely reversing signs or slowing sickness progression.

Blood Conditions and Bone Marrow Transplants: Hematopoietic stem cells (HSCs) happen to be applied for decades in bone marrow transplants to deal with blood Conditions like leukemia and lymphoma. These transplants change the client’s diseased bone marrow with healthy stem cells that could deliver new blood cells.

Drug Advancement and Screening: Stem cells can be employed to make ailment products, permitting researchers to review disorder mechanisms and test new medicines in the managed ecosystem. This could accelerate the development of new treatment options and decrease the need to have for animal tests.

Individualized Drugs: Down the road, stem cells could be used to make customized treatment options customized to a person's genetic makeup. This could lead to more effective therapies with fewer Unwanted effects.

Issues and Long term Instructions in Stem Mobile Study
Despite the promising potential of stem cells, there are various difficulties that researchers ought to conquer ahead of stem mobile therapies could become a typical Component of medical apply.

Basic safety Fears: Among the major troubles is making sure the safety of stem cell therapies. There's a threat that stem cells could differentiate into unintended cell sorts or variety tumors. Scientists are working to know and Handle these pitfalls to acquire Harmless and helpful treatments.

Immune Rejection: Just like organ transplants, stem cell transplants can be turned down via the receiver's immune procedure. Experts are Discovering approaches to avoid immune rejection, for example employing iPSCs derived through the individual's very own cells.

Regulatory Hurdles: The development of stem cell therapies is subject to demanding regulatory oversight to be certain basic safety and efficacy. This process may be time-consuming and dear, but it surely is vital for safeguarding sufferers.

Technical Challenges: Developing responsible procedures for increasing, differentiating, and delivering stem cells is a substantial technological problem. Advances in biotechnology, for example 3D bioprinting and gene editing, are assisting to deal with these worries and pave just how for new therapies.
